Westgate reopening summary

I would have gone on Facebook Live today if Westgate Lanes changed drastically for the pandemic’s aftermath, but they didn’t install anything special, so I decided just to write a normal post. I was briefed by Yogi Patel and Tim Major, however, and they were able to report that the roof and air conditioning were repaired during the shutdown (likely during Phase 1 of the reopening in Massachusetts), and the facility has been given a thorough cleaning.

Westgate’s capacity for bowling will be 300, and masks will be required as you enter the facility, and you don’t have to wear them while you are bowling (in the settee area), but you must when you are going through the building. For the bowlers using house balls, those will be disinfected and wrapped in plastic as they are returned. Westgate is also encouraging social distancing where they can, with markers on the floor at various places in the establishment:

These are in front of the desk.
And these are in the snack bar and pro shop area.

Kevin Thibeault has also informed me that only two people other than staff (mostly he & Alex Aguiar) will be allowed in the pro shop at a time.
